I moved from a 509" BBC to a 555" one. Same engine just opened up the bore and changed the stroke. I left everything else the same save for adding a vacuum pump. Same heads, camshaft, intake, carb and ignition.
I run a 8" convertor with a flash of 6100-6200 & its spragless. How big an effect would the additional cubes have on the convertor? Combination at the moment just seems "off" from what it was before the size change.

Depends on the increase or decrease in power.
100hp is 400 rpm's of observed stall, as example.

The 555 will not work well with the same parts.
Heads to small, cam way to small.
More low end torque but it’ll run out of steam as rpm rises.
Just last year I upped my engine from a 565 to a 584
Same heads and cam
The 584 is weaker than the engine as a 565.
Has more torque down low but that’s it...
Same converter is a little bit looser.
I ran a 509 with an 8” converter and went to a 9” when I built the 565
I can recall feeling like I never should have sold the 8” and just tried it behind that 565
I think it would have been just fine
